The 2026 Sound Burger Phenomenon
The Audio-Technica Sound Burger (AT-SB727) has re-established itself as a critical asset for vinyl enthusiasts in 2026. Originally a cult classic from the 1980s, the modern iteration balances retro aesthetics with contemporary requirements such as Bluetooth connectivity and USB-C charging. For collectors in the Philippines, obtaining this specific hardware remains a challenge due to limited local distribution and high markup from secondary market resellers.

Philippines Import Tax and Customs Protocols
When executing international shipping to the Philippines, understanding the de minimis threshold is vital for cost management. Under current regulations, shipments with a total value (including insurance and freight) below ₱10,000 are generally exempt from import tax and duties. Since the Sound Burger AT-SB727 typically retails around $199 USD, it often falls near this threshold depending on the current exchange rate in 2026.
